Sturgeon

Fish, mixed species, cooked, dry heat

Fat 36%Protein 64%
Percent Calories

½ piece of sturgeon (Fish, mixed species, cooked, dry heat) contains 98 Calories The macronutrient breakdown is 0% carbs, 36% fat, and 64% protein. This is a good source of protein (27% of your Daily Value), vitamin d (62% of your Daily Value), and potassium (6% of your Daily Value).
